    Chapter 9 SELLING CRUISES WHO BUYS CRUISES • • • Restless baby boomers. constitute the largest segment of cruisers (33%). They’re in their 40s and 50s‚ are thrifty‚ family oriented‚ and a little wary of new things. Because they’re still supporting children‚ they respond positively to the cost-saving of a cruise. The posadas are mainly celebrated in Mexico and other parts of Central America. Such as: El Salvador‚ Guatemala‚ Costa Rica and Honduras. To this day Las posadas is a tradition that still continue.
